THE SUFFRAGETTES.

FOROXBIjE feeding

‘‘Times and Sydney Sun Service. ” United Press Association.—By Electric Telegraph. —Copyright. Received July-17, 9 a.m. Loudon, July 16.

Sir Victor Horsley and other doctors are forming a Forcible Feeding Protest Committee. They deputationised Mr McKenna, who refused reporters leave to take notes and the deputation consequently withdrew.
